Women's Lacrosse Drops Opener to Hopkins, 17-9
2/10/2019 2:18:00 PM | Women's Lacrosse
PHILADELPHIA - The Drexel women's lacrosse team came up short in its season opener on Sunday afternoon at Vidas Field, falling to Johns Hopkins, 17-9. The Dragons allowed the game's first three goals and could not climb back closer than two the rest of the way.
Colleen Grady and Courtney Dietzel each scored a pair of goals in the loss, with Grady adding an assist. Karson Harris had a goal and a helper along with three draw controls. Sigourney Heerink, who entered in the second half, came up with six saves in goal while allowing five of the Blue Jays' 17 scores. Caroline Cummings, Cassidy Delaney, Claire Jarema and Marah Hayes also scored for Drexel, with Jarema winning three draws and Cummings two. Lucy Schneidereith forced three Hopkins turnovers and Jamie Schneidereith caused two more, as did Arden Edgerton.
After Hopkins got off to its quick start, scoring three times in the first 5:18 of the game, the Dragons and Blue Jays traded goals for most of the rest of the first half. It was 7-5 Johns Hopkins with 6:50 remaining before halftime, but the Blue Jays were able to string together a pair of scores late in the half to take a 9-5 lead into the break.
Courtney Dietzel responded with the first goal of the second half, pulling Drexel back within three. Hopkins wasted little time responding, again scoring three quick goals, this time in the span of 1:08. The duo of Harris and Grady got two of the goals back to make it 12-8 with still 22:37 to go and Dietzel netted another after a Johns Hopkins goal to make it 13-9 with 10:42 remaining, but that would be as close as the Dragons could get. The Blue Jays scored the game's final four goals to ice the game away and get Drexel's season underway with a defeat.
The Dragons will be back in action next Saturday, Feb. 16, when the Dragons visit Iona at 1 p.m.
